Back in 2018, Dan White was completing his deep diver certification when he came across a whitetip shark.
He thought it was a ‘cool encounter’ and decided to start filming while it swam its way over to his diving group. The man had come across three sharks very recently ‘with no trouble at all’, hence the confidence in whipping out his camera.

However, as the horrifying YouTube clip shows, things took a terrible turn.
Several German drivers who were swimming in the same area joined with White’s group, with the shark’s behaviour began to change.
He told Tracking Sharks in 2018: "As I was filming, I noticed that one of the outlet diver’s bubbles spooked the shark and it turned to investigate."
In the video, you can see the shark making its way to the diver’s level and swimming towards them.

The animal then begins to attack a diver, with the clip showing it biting into its victim’s leg.
Dan retold this scary encounter to the BBC’s Why Sharks Attack: "It bit into the diver's leg, latched on, thrashed around and ended up going over almost like a cartwheel.
"It was crazy, it wouldn't let go for what felt like forever. It ended up tearing his calf muscle completely off his leg."

The man’s calf was ripped to shreds and the shark had not only completely destroyed his calf muscle but also bitten down to the bone.
"There was a big plume of blood in the water. Another diver started screaming you could hear her scream - a shriek noise in your ear," Dan said.
"It's horrifying to listen to."

Despite the group being 10 metres below the water’s surface, you can hear the scream in the video. After the shark attack, the man was helped up to the surface where he was heaved out from the water.
Before being rushed to shore, first responders administered pain medication and applied a tourniquet to the man’s leg, which miraculously didn’t need to be amputated. He was then taken to hospital.
